Understanding Nonavailability Certificates
A Nonavailability Certificate is a document that confirms the absence of an official birth record at any Birth Department. It serves as evidence that no birth registration exists for a particular individual. These certificates are particularly relevant for late registrations or when the birth occurred many years ago.Why Nonavailability Certificates Matter
Late Registrations: When birth was not registered promptly, a Nonavailability Certificate allows individuals to rectify this oversight.Historical Births: For births that took place years ago, obtaining a Nonavailability Certificate is essential for legal and administrative purposes.
Process of Obtaining a GHMC Nonavailability Certificate
Hospital Births
1) Hospitals directly enter birth events online.
2) After verification by the Registrar of Births and Deaths, citizens can collect their certificates from MeeSeva centers.Home Births
1) Relatives of the birth person should obtain an immunization card from the concerned hospital.
2) Visit a MeeSeva center to apply for the Birth Certificate.3) After updating the details, the Birth Certificate can be obtained from MeeSeva.
Late Registration of Births
The GHMC provides a process for late registration for unregistered births. Individuals can walk into any eSeva center and fill out an application form for Nonavailability GHMC Certificates of birth.How to Apply for a Nonavailability Certificate
1) Create a MeeSeva Citizen login.2) Visit the TS MeeSeva Official Portal.
3) Log in as a Citizen.
4) Search for “Nonavailability” in the home search bar.
5) Select the Nonavailability Service.
6) Fill in the required details.
